Summary
Overview
Work History
Education
Skills
Work Availability
Affiliations
Quote
Work Preference
Software
Interests
Websites
Timeline
Generic
Brett Walker

Brett Walker

Database Architect / Developer
Franklin,Tennessee

Summary

An experienced IT professional specializing in Microsoft SQL Server; focused on T-SQL development including stored procedures, query tuning, server tuning, database architecture and design, SSIS, and SSRS. Experience managing teams of developers, DBAs, and BI/SSIS developers.

Overview

22
22
years of professional experience

Work History

Senior BI Developer

Trexis Insurance
Franklin
11.2022 - 05.2024
  • Developed and maintained complex SSIS packages
  • Developed T-SQL code (stored procedures, ad-hoc queries, etc.) to efficiently respond to business needs
  • Created CSV files using T-SQL to load an AgentSync Salesforce database
  • Implemented Git source control for Business Intelligence SSIS packages
  • Implemented Red Gate SQL Source Control for SQL Server databases
  • Developed SQL code on AS-400 with IBM DB2 and RPG.

Senior Developer

HealthStream
Nashville
08.2020 - 10.2021
  • Developed and maintained SSIS packages to generate reports and .txt files for delivery to customers
  • Developed and supported SQL Server stored procedures to retrieve data used by SSIS packages described above.

Database Engineer

Sovereign Sportsman Solutions
Nashville
12.2019 - 03.2020
  • Developed SSIS packages in SQL Server 2016 to process hunting and fishing license extracts and FTP them to the client for processing
  • Deployed SSIS packages to production
  • Developed complex T-SQL stored procedures, views, and ad-hoc queries in SQL Server 2016 to determine eligibility for hunting and fishing licenses
  • Configured and implemented log shipping in SQL Server 2016
  • Developed a database diagram in TOAD from the existing database which was contractually required as documentation to be delivered to the client
  • Developed and supported stored procedures in SQL Server 2016 to load the legacy data as well as write SQL scripts to correct production data issues
  • Wrote ad-hoc queries to assist users with database questions and data anomalies.

Solutions Architect

AdhereHealth
Brentwood
04.2018 - 12.2019
  • Developed the architecture for a new Software as a Service (SaaS) application using SQL Server 2016
  • The application housed multiple clients, was user configurable, and used a common code base
  • Developed SSIS packages in SQL Server 2016
  • Developed stored procedures to determine CMS Star ratings
  • Developed data flow diagrams for existing applications and systems
  • Generated database diagrams of existing databases
  • These diagrams improved the understanding of database objects and the relationship between them
  • Managed the stored procedures, views, and ad-hoc queries to refactor a major application
  • This refactor enhanced performance, improved maintainability, and increased overall accuracy of the application
  • Implemented git source control for C# code, SSIS packages, and SQL Server stored procedures, etc.

Database Team Lead

Cigna Healthspring
Nashville
07.2016 - 04.2018
  • Maintained SSIS packages and T-SQL stored procedures in SQL Server 2016 that processed claims data for CMS Risk Adjustment Payment System (RAPS)
  • Designed synchronization process which synchronized data modifications on a production OLTP server to a dedicated report server
  • Responsible for the overall architecture of the process and database design
  • The sync process was developed in SSIS and stored procedures in SQL Server 2016
  • Researched performance problems and determined potential improvements related to stored procedures, indexes, application architecture, and data hygiene
  • Developed and modified functionality, fixed bugs, and improved performance
  • Reverse engineered existing databases to better understand current database design
  • Used resulting model to determine and propose improvements in architecture.

BI Developer

Community Health Systems
Franklin
07.2015 - 07.2016
  • Developed accounting and financial reports (income statements, balance sheets, etc.) using SSRS and SQL Server 2008 R2
  • Designed the database tables and stored procedures for use in processing the reports
  • Developed reports in SSRS
  • Worked on a project that allowed the accounting team to create customized reports for the business user that would have taken months if developed in the corporate accounting system.

BI Developer

Deloitte, Electronic Discovery Division
Nashville
05.2015 - 07.2015
  • Analyzed electronically discovered data to be used by legal counsel in court cases
  • This included reviewing hundreds or thousands of documents (emails, Word Documents, mobile device information, etc.) for specific words, phrases, and/or patterns
  • The criteria for pulling the data from these documents was extremely complex and required advanced T-SQL code and techniques
  • Analyzed existing database looking for ways to improve performance and reliability.

Senior Manager – Data Services

ServiceSource
Franklin
01.2013 - 05.2015
  • Managed team of eight Data Analysts responsible for data content and quality in Microsoft Dynamics CRM
  • Responsibilities included ETL (SSIS), data updates, and data analysis
  • Data loads (ETL) followed complex business rules and generated detailed exception reports as well as executive summaries for management
  • Loaded client data into the ServiceSource CRM
  • Applied complex business logic via stored procedures as well as transformations in SSIS
  • Incoming data was complex and changed often
  • Business rules varied by client, so the SSIS packages and stored procedures had to be easily changed to meet each client’s needs.

Owner / Consultant

Prism Data Solutions
Franklin
06.2010 - 01.2013
  • Consultant for Harmony Information Systems
  • Lead DBA reporting to CTO
  • Responsible for 200+ production databases
  • Duties included query performance tuning, server performance tuning, managing projects and tasks for off-shore DBA team, and ensuring database up-time and performance met service level agreements
  • Consultant for Celera Group
  • Consolidated 52 individual databases into a single centralized database
  • Developed complex T-SQL scripts to purge data according to business rules defined by client
  • Purge scripts were complex due to the number of tables, FK relationships, constraints, etc
  • Performed database tuning and suggested ways to improve performance.

Database Architect

Solveras Payment Solutions
Franklin
04.2009 - 06.2010
  • Performed design analysis of existing database using reverse engineering
  • The reverse engineered database was used when designing the new database to ensure all data was accurately captured in the new database
  • Designed a new database in SQL Server 2008 from scratch to replace an existing poorly designed and inefficient database and support a new CRM application simultaneously under development
  • Followed database best practices including normalization and referential integrity
  • Developed SSIS packages to migrate data from old database to new
  • SSIS packages scrubbed the data and converted free-form text to columns, used foreign keys, and enforced referential integrity
  • Developed SSIS packages to copy data from credit card application database to CRM database for tracking and reports
  • Developed SSIS package to generate files for transmission to credit card processor
  • Developed SSIS package to read incoming files from credit card processor to support invoicing to merchant, reporting, and customer service
  • Created reports in SSRS for management, customer service, and accounting
  • Supported credit card payment application development and ongoing maintenance
  • Continued to improve data integrity, develop and modify SSRS reports, and improve performance.

Software Developer

Passport Health Communications
Franklin
04.2008 - 04.2009
  • Developed tool to synchronize configuration data between production and QA in VB.NET/ASP.NET/SQL Server for internal use to ease QA testing
  • Developed tool in VB.NET/SQL Server to help QA in finding and capturing transactions for use in testing
  • This tool determined the file(s) to search for the transaction
  • When found, it parsed each of these files until it found the required transaction
  • Debugged and maintained various VB.NET/SQL Server production applications.

Database Administration – Manager

Link2Gov (a Metavante Company)
Nashville
03.2007 - 03.2008
  • Managed staff of six DBA’s responsible for over twenty production databases
  • Responsibilities included backups, index tuning, query tuning, architecture, design, and database security
  • Experience with Merge Replication and Transactional Replication
  • Helped with architecture of new production environment.

Manager, Application Systems Analysis/Programming

Emdeon Business Services (formerly WebMD)
Nashville
06.2002 - 02.2007
  • Manager for six-person development team
  • Delegated assignments based upon resource availability and expertise
  • Worked with EDI – specifically ANSI X12 835, 837, and 997 transactions
  • Developed extremely complex Stored Procedures to query Meta Data database
  • Database was housed in SQL Server 2000 but the database design was not a typical normalized database
  • All claim data was stored in a single 4-column table
  • For example, to store last name and first name would take 2 rows in this table
  • The data was hierarchical with multiple nested hierarchies per claim
  • It was critical that queries be as efficient as possible since the primary table reached over 1 billion rows by month end
  • Migrated all databases to SQL Server 2005 (Meta Data database and traditional OLTP databases)
  • Lead four-person team for designing database for Code Sets Consolidation project
  • This database was intended to house multiple disparate code sets (diagnosis codes, procedure codes, etc.) in a “single source of truth database.” When implemented, this project reduced costs significantly by allowing the company to buy only one set of code sets.

Education

Bachelor of Science - Computer Information Systems

Murray State University
Murray, KY

Skills

  • Microsoft SQL Server
  • Database Administration
  • T-SQL query development
  • Database design and architecture
  • SQL Server Integration Services (SSIS)
  • EDI (ANSI X12 835, 837, 997 Transactions)
  • SQL Server Reporting Services (SSRS)
  • Git
  • Critical thinking abilities
  • Performance Tuning
  • Data Modeling
  • Source and Version Control: Git, Github
  • Teamwork and Collaboration
  • JIRA

Work Availability

monday
tuesday
wednesday
thursday
friday
saturday
sunday
morning
afternoon
evening
swipe to browse

Affiliations

  • Association of Information Technology Professionals

Quote

There is a powerful driving force inside every human being that, once unleashed, can make any vision, dream, or desire a reality.
Tony Robbins

Work Preference

Work Type

Full TimeContract Work

Software

Microsoft SQL Server

SQL Server Management Studio

SQL Server Integration Services (SSIS)

SQL Server Reporting Services (SSRS)

Erwin Data Modeler

Git Source Control

Jira

Microsoft Office

Microsoft Teams

WebEx

Visual Studio

Interests

Microsoft SQL Server

Woodworking

Aviation

Reading

Gardening

Photography

Timeline

Senior BI Developer

Trexis Insurance
11.2022 - 05.2024

Senior Developer

HealthStream
08.2020 - 10.2021

Database Engineer

Sovereign Sportsman Solutions
12.2019 - 03.2020

Solutions Architect

AdhereHealth
04.2018 - 12.2019

Database Team Lead

Cigna Healthspring
07.2016 - 04.2018

BI Developer

Community Health Systems
07.2015 - 07.2016

BI Developer

Deloitte, Electronic Discovery Division
05.2015 - 07.2015

Senior Manager – Data Services

ServiceSource
01.2013 - 05.2015

Owner / Consultant

Prism Data Solutions
06.2010 - 01.2013

Database Architect

Solveras Payment Solutions
04.2009 - 06.2010

Software Developer

Passport Health Communications
04.2008 - 04.2009

Database Administration – Manager

Link2Gov (a Metavante Company)
03.2007 - 03.2008

Manager, Application Systems Analysis/Programming

Emdeon Business Services (formerly WebMD)
06.2002 - 02.2007

Bachelor of Science - Computer Information Systems

Murray State University
Brett WalkerDatabase Architect / Developer